social impact refers to the effect that an individual, organization, or company has on the surrounding community and society as a whole. It encompasses the changes and improvements made to address social issues and create positive outcomes for the community. Understanding and maximizing social impact is crucial in making a meaningful difference in the world and creating a more sustainable and inclusive society.
There are various ways in which social impact can be achieved, ranging from philanthropic efforts to sustainable business practices. One of the most common ways to make a positive social impact is through charitable donations and volunteering. By supporting organizations and initiatives that address social issues such as poverty, education, healthcare, and environmental sustainability, individuals and companies can contribute to positive change and improve the lives of others.
Another way to maximize social impact is through corporate social responsibility (CSR) initiatives. Companies can integrate social and environmental concerns into their business operations and decision-making processes to minimize negative impacts and create shared value for society. This can include initiatives such as reducing carbon emissions, promoting diversity and inclusion in the workplace, and supporting local communities through charitable projects and partnerships.
In recent years, social entrepreneurship has emerged as a powerful vehicle for creating social impact. Social entrepreneurs are individuals who start businesses with the primary goal of addressing social issues and making a positive impact on society. These businesses often operate as hybrid models, blending traditional for-profit business practices with a social mission to drive meaningful change. By harnessing the power of business and innovation, social entrepreneurs are able to tackle complex social problems and create sustainable solutions.
Measuring social impact is an essential part of understanding the effectiveness of social initiatives and ensuring that resources are being used efficiently and effectively. There are various tools and methodologies available for measuring social impact, including social return on investment (SROI), impact assessments, and key performance indicators (KPIs). By collecting and analyzing data on the social outcomes and results of their actions, individuals and organizations can track their progress, identify areas for improvement, and demonstrate the value of their efforts to stakeholders and the wider community.
